The Film 'Emily': A Fresh Look
The 2022 film "Emily" is truly a fresh and rather compelling take on the life of Emily Brontë. It was written and directed by Frances O'Connor, marking her debut as a director, which is quite an achievement. The movie documents Emily's brief yet very eventful life, focusing on the period as she was writing her first book. It's a sensual, gothic tale, portraying Emma Mackey as Emily Brontë, and it imagines the events that might have led up to her creating one of the greatest novels of all time. You can watch the new trailer for #EmilyMovie to get a sense of it, and it really lets you delve into the mind behind 'Wuthering Heights', which is pretty cool.
This film is not a strict documentary, but rather an imagined drama. It traces the relationships that significantly shaped Emily Brontë, and, in a way, inspired her masterpiece, 'Wuthering Heights'. The film imagines Emily Brontë's own gothic story, the one that truly inspired her seminal novel. It’s a very personal look, so, it tries to get inside her head and heart. The movie is available on DVD and digital download now, for anyone curious to see this particular interpretation of her life and the forces that drove her creative process.
